Summary of Changes

Hello @zbb88888, I'm Gemini Code Assist1! I'm currently reviewing this pull request and will post my feedback shortly. In the meantime, here's a summary to help you and other reviewers quickly get up to speed!

This pull request addresses a bug where the kube-ovn-speaker component was not generating logs, hindering the ability to diagnose and troubleshoot issues. By introducing specific logging arguments, the change ensures that critical operational data from the speaker is consistently recorded, significantly improving the observability and debuggability of the Kube-OVN network.

Highlights

  • Kube-OVN Speaker Logging: Explicitly configured the kube-ovn-speaker component to output logs to a dedicated file (/var/log/kube-ovn/kube-ovn-speaker.log) and also to stderr. This ensures that speaker logs are captured for debugging and operational monitoring.
  • Log File Management: Set a maximum size of 200MB for the kube-ovn-speaker log file, preventing it from consuming excessive disk space.

Code Review

This pull request addresses an issue where kube-ovn-speaker was not producing logs on the host. It achieves this by adding several command-line arguments to the kube-ovn-speaker container in both the Helm chart (charts/kube-ovn-v2/templates/speaker/speaker.yaml) and the static manifest (yamls/speaker.yaml). The added arguments correctly configure klog to write logs to a file that is mounted from the host.

My review focuses on improving the maintainability and configurability of these changes. I've suggested making the hardcoded log file size configurable in the Helm chart and adding a guiding comment in the static manifest. These changes will make the configuration more flexible and user-friendly.
